Q: Is 150,420,029 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 150,420,029 is a composite number.

Why is 150,420,029 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 150,420,029 can be evenly divided by 1 17 31 79 527 1,343 2,449 3,613 41,633 61,421 112,003 285,427 1,904,051 4,852,259 8,848,237 and 150,420,029, with no remainder.

Since 150,420,029 cannot be divided by just 1 and 150,420,029, it is a composite number.
